Types of Patio Doors Offered by Chinese Manufacturers

Chinese patio door manufacturers commonly supply sliding, French, folding, and lift-slide systems. Sliding doors save terrace space and suit compact apartments. French doors open wide, but require clear swing areas. Folding systems create broad openings for villas and restaurants. Lift-slide doors support larger glass panels with smoother operation.

The U.S. Department of Energy reports that windows can cause 25% to 30% of residential heating and cooling energy use. Door selection therefore needs more than visual appeal. Ask for U-values, solar heat gain coefficients, air leakage, and water penetration results. NFRC labeling offers a useful comparison framework. Thermally broken aluminum frames improve insulation, while low-E double glazing reduces heat transfer. Triple glazing may help cold regions, but it adds weight and cost. It is not always necessary.

For global projects, Chinese factories can configure low thresholds, concealed drainage, insect screens, laminated glass, and different opening directions. The International Energy Agency’s 2023 buildings report states that buildings consume about 30% of global final energy. Energy performance deserves serious attention. A common mistake is trusting catalog images too quickly. Check rollers, corner joints, seals, hardware, and packaging. Request repeated-cycle and simulated-rain testing. One sample is not enough. A factory video proves little. Written specifications protect the buyer.

Key Features and Materials of China-Made Patio Doors

China-made patio doors increasingly combine slim profiles, large glass areas, and configurable hardware for global projects. Aluminium remains popular because it resists warping and supports narrow sightlines. Thermal-break aluminium performs better than standard profiles, especially when reinforced with polyamide strips. uPVC offers stronger insulation at a lower cost, but its frame thickness may reduce the glass area. Timber-aluminium systems feel warmer and more refined, though they require stricter moisture control.

Glass selection deserves equal attention. Low-emissivity double glazing can reduce heat transfer, while argon filling improves insulation between panes.

The U.S. Department of Energy reports that windows and doors can cause 25–30% of residential heating and cooling energy use. This figure makes glazing performance commercially important, not decorative.

Tempered or laminated glass improves impact safety and sound control. Multi-point locks, stainless-steel rollers, and corrosion-resistant tracks also matter in coastal environments.

Factory claims still need verification. Ask for U-values, air leakage, water penetration, and structural test results, preferably under recognized standards such as NFRC, AAMA, or EN procedures. A beautiful sample can hide weak drainage design. That is the uncomfortable part. Buyers should inspect corner joints, gasket compression, drainage holes, and powder-coating thickness before placing volume orders. The International Energy Agency continues to identify building-envelope efficiency as a major route to lower building energy demand. Yet no material works perfectly everywhere; climate, installation quality, and maintenance can change the final result.

How to Evaluate Chinese Patio Door Manufacturers

For global buyers, evaluating Chinese patio door manufacturers requires more than comparing catalog prices. A credible supplier can explain its extrusion alloy, thermal-break design, glass specification, and coating process. Ask for drawings, section samples, and test reports from recognized laboratories. Do not accept vague claims. Check whether air leakage, water resistance, and wind-load results match the exact door system you will purchase. Small detail, major risk.

Request a factory video call during production, not only a polished showroom tour. Look at profile storage, cutting equipment, assembly benches, and finished-door protection. Ask how operators record dimensions, glass clearance, hardware torque, and surface defects. A reliable manufacturer should show batch records and explain corrective actions. It should also confirm packaging tests, container loading plans, lead times, and replacement procedures for damaged parts. Promises are easy.

Before signing, order a paid sample and inspect it as an installer would. Slide the panels repeatedly. Check rollers, locks, seals, drainage holes, corner joints, and alignment. Compare the sample with approved drawings. Clarify tolerances, warranty coverage, payment milestones, and export documentation responsibilities. Certifications matter, but they do not replace independent inspection. No factory is perfect. I would rather see an admitted weakness and a measured improvement plan than hear flawless answers. That judgment may take longer, yet it often prevents expensive rework at the job site.

Quality Standards, Certifications, and Customization Options

China’s top patio door manufacturers are often judged by finish, price, and delivery speed. Serious buyers should look deeper. Quality begins with stable aluminum, accurate profiles, durable seals, and controlled glass production. Details matter.

Ask for documented air, water, and wind-load testing before approving a large order. Test reports should match the exact door system, glass thickness, and hardware configuration. Certifications may include ISO 9001 for quality management, CE marking for applicable European products, or regional energy ratings. Requirements differ by destination, so one certificate cannot prove universal compliance. Samples reveal more than brochures. Check corner joints, rollers, locking points, drainage holes, and powder coating under strong light. Small defects become expensive after installation.

Customization is another important strength. Manufacturers may adjust opening sizes, frame colors, glass performance, screen systems, thresholds, and handle positions. However, every change can affect cost, lead time, thermal performance, or testing results. Confirm drawings before production. Request a physical sample for unusual finishes. I have seen attractive specifications fail because the installer received unclear tolerances. That mistake is avoidable.

Reliable suppliers also explain limitations instead of promising everything. A low-U-value glass unit may increase weight and require stronger rollers. Oversized panels may need special packaging and lifting equipment. Buyers should review inspection records, packing photographs, replacement-part procedures, and warranty terms. Factory visits help, but they are not perfect proof. Ongoing communication and independent pre-shipment inspection provide stronger confidence.

Global Buying, Pricing, Shipping, and Installation Considerations

Buying patio doors from China requires more than comparing catalog prices. Ask manufacturers for thermal ratings, frame materials, glass specifications, warranty terms, and recent export experience. A low quotation may exclude hardware, packaging, testing, or inland transport. Request a detailed pro forma invoice with currency, minimum order quantity, production time, and Incoterms. Measure twice. Small errors become expensive after production.

Shipping also affects the real landed cost. Confirm whether the doors will travel by container, consolidated freight, or another method. Protective corner guards, moisture barriers, and reinforced crates reduce damage during long transit. Check customs documents with your broker before payment. Local building codes may require specific safety glass, insulation values, or emergency exits. Installation needs equal attention. Heavy sliding panels often require two or three trained workers, a level opening, and proper drainage. An installation guide is useful, but local site conditions can defeat a perfect plan. Delays happen.

Tips: Compare at least three written quotations, not screenshots. Request a sample or detailed pre-production drawings. Verify dimensions in millimeters and inches. Keep a contingency budget for duties, storage, and replacement parts. Inspect the container and cartons immediately after arrival, recording photos and measurements. If the supplier avoids technical questions, reconsider the order. Cheap doors are not always economical.

Category Data Point Typical Range or Requirement Global Buyer Considerations
Product Types Aluminum Sliding Patio Door Commonly supplied with two or three panels, insulated glass, powder-coated or anodized frames, and multi-point or hook locks. Suitable for modern residential projects. Confirm thermal-break construction, drainage design, wind-load calculations, and corrosion resistance before ordering.
Product Types uPVC Sliding Patio Door Typically uses multi-chamber profiles, steel reinforcement, insulated glass, weather seals, and reinforced rollers. Generally offers good thermal insulation at a lower cost. Check profile wall thickness, reinforcement size, ultraviolet resistance, and color stability for hot climates.
Product Types Thermally Broken Aluminum Door Includes a polyamide thermal barrier between interior and exterior aluminum sections; often available with low-emissivity double or triple glazing. A practical choice for cold or mixed climates. Request tested U-values for the complete door assembly rather than for the glass alone.
Product Types Lift-and-Slide Patio Door Uses a raised sash mechanism and heavy-duty rollers to support larger panels; opening heights around 2.1–3.0 m are commonly requested. Provides smooth operation for large openings but requires accurate structural support, level thresholds, reinforced packaging, and professional installation.
Pricing Indicative Factory Pricing Approximate FOB China ranges for a standard residential unit around 2.4 m × 2.1 m: uPVC about US$180–500; standard aluminum about US$250–700; thermally broken aluminum about US$350–1,000; premium lift-and-slide systems about US$700–1,800. Prices vary with frame depth, glass specification, hardware, finish, opening size, screens, packaging, order volume, and testing requirements. Use these figures for early budgeting only.
Customization Standard and Bespoke Dimensions Typical residential heights are approximately 2.0–2.4 m. Widths commonly range from 1.8–3.6 m, while wider systems require engineered panels and structural review. Provide approved architectural drawings, handing direction, sill height, drainage details, tolerances, and local code requirements before production.
Glass Glazing Options Common configurations include 5+12A+5 mm or 6+16A+6 mm double glazing; laminated, tempered, low-emissivity, and triple-glazed options are also available. Select glass according to safety, climate, acoustic, and energy requirements. Confirm safety glazing locations and spacer type for the destination market.
Performance Thermal and Weather Performance Whole-door thermal performance depends on frame, glass, spacer, seals, and size. Air permeability, watertightness, wind resistance, and U-value should be verified by test reports. Do not compare products using glass-only values. Request reports based on the complete tested assembly and check compatibility with local building regulations.
Ordering Minimum Order Quantity and Sampling Stock or standard products may be available in small quantities; customized projects commonly require several units or a project-based order. Samples may be charged separately. Confirm whether sample, tooling, color-matching, testing, and design fees are refundable or credited against a production order.
Production Typical Manufacturing Lead Time Approximately 20–35 days for standard repeat orders and about 35–60 days for customized systems, excluding approval delays and peak-season congestion. The production clock should begin only after drawings, colors, hardware, glass, payment terms, and technical specifications are formally approved.
Quality Control Pre-Shipment Inspection Inspection should cover dimensions, diagonals, frame finish, glass markings, hardware operation, drainage holes, seals, labels, accessories, and packaging condition. Use an agreed inspection checklist and sampling level. For large projects, inspect the first production batch before completing the full shipment.
Packaging Export Protection Typical protection includes corner guards, foam or honeycomb separators, moisture-resistant wrapping, reinforced cartons or wooden crates, and clear identification labels. Confirm whether wooden materials comply with ISPM 15 requirements. Request packaging photos and loading plans for fragile glass products.
Shipping Container and Freight Planning Large glazed doors are usually shipped by sea in protective racks or crates. Freight cost depends on packed volume, weight, destination port, season, and selected Incoterm. Calculate freight using packed dimensions rather than product dimensions. Confirm whether the quotation is EXW, FOB, CIF, or delivered to a named destination.
Shipping Indicative Ocean Transit Time Port-to-port transit commonly ranges from about 15–25 days within Asia, 25–40 days to Europe, and 20–45 days to North America, excluding customs and inland delivery. Allow additional time for factory pickup, export clearance, transshipment, destination customs, port handling, and final-mile delivery.
Trade Terms Duties, Taxes, and Import Documents Potential documents include commercial invoice, packing list, bill of lading, certificate of origin, product test reports, and fumigation or wood-packaging documents where applicable. Import duty, value-added tax, building-product regulations, and documentation requirements differ by country. Verify the correct HS classification with a customs professional.
Installation Site Preparation The opening should be structurally sound, square, plumb, level, dry, and prepared with suitable sill support. Installation gaps must follow the approved system details. Measure the finished opening after accounting for flooring, waterproofing, insulation, flashing, and interior or exterior finishes.
Installation Installation Method Typical work includes dry fitting, shimming, mechanical fixing, perimeter sealing, sill drainage, panel adjustment, and operational testing. Use trained installers for heavy or lift-and-slide doors. Incorrect leveling or excessive sealant can cause roller wear, water leakage, or difficult operation.
Maintenance Routine Care Clean tracks and drainage channels, inspect seals, lubricate compatible hardware, tighten fixings, and remove salt or abrasive deposits from exterior surfaces. Coastal projects require more frequent cleaning and corrosion checks. Avoid abrasive cleaners and incompatible chemicals on coated or anodized finishes.
Warranty After-Sales Coverage Commercial warranty periods commonly range from 1–5 years depending on the component and contract; glass breakage and installation errors may be excluded. Obtain written coverage for frames, finish, insulated-glass seal failure, hardware, rollers, and replacement-part availability before placing the order.
All prices, lead times, dimensions, and transit periods are indicative planning ranges for international procurement. Final specifications and costs should be confirmed against approved drawings, written quotations, applicable local codes, and the agreed Incoterm.
